**A place to make a difference**:
In this maximum term, part time position (9 days per fortnight until end of June 2027, with potential for permanency) you’ll work within a case management framework in a refuge and outreach setting, providing support to children and families who are experiencing domestic and family violence.

Based in the Moreton Bay region, you’ll work 68.4 hours per fortnight, as follows:

- Week 1: 7.6 hours per day from Monday to Friday
- Week 2: 7.6 hours per day from Monday to Thursday.

These hours will be operated from the refuge and in community settings, all located within the Moreton Bay region.
- You will make a difference by: _
- Providing holistic case management, delivering support to vulnerable and disadvantaged clients and supporting relationships for favourable client outcomes
- Identifying strengths, establishing goals for the program and reviewing client progress towards these goals
- Promoting skills which increase health, safety and development
- Enhancing stakeholder relationships and partnerships with the view of providing clients with support that will help them to address their needs
- Working collaboratively within a small team to deliver best practice to women and children who are experiencing DFV

**A place to feel valued**:
You’re an experienced practitioner who is passionate about supporting families within a child centred, strengths-based framework. Importantly, you have a strong understanding of the impact of trauma on children and their families and you’re keenly aware of the additional impacts and barriers experienced by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ander families.
- It is a genuine requirement of this position that it be filled by a woman as permitted in sections 25, 104 and 105 of the Anti-Discrimination Act, 1991._
- This role requires: _
- Demonstrated experience in case management and knowledge of relevant legislation
- Knowledge and previous experience working in the Domestic and Family Violence or closely related human services context
- Demonstrated experience and understanding of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ander communities and families
- Strong report writing, analytical and evaluation skills, including data collection and analysis
- Tertiary qualification in a relevant field and/or significant experience working in a similar service
